Khata is one of the essential legal tax documents. It is required when you approve a property for business. Khata is essentially an account of a person who has a property in Bangalore that contains the tax details of the property. This Khata account, that is, it is essentially owned by the Municipal Corporation. If you opt for a home loan, you will need the real estate card. This map of your property must be approved by the competent legal body to be reviewed by the lender. It will approve the fact that the construction of the property is legal and has been completed in accordance with the rules and regulations established by the legal body. This is one of the most important real estate documents you need at the time of a home loan. When you think about why you need that particular real estate document, the answer is to prove to the lender that said property has no mortgages or mortgages due. Without submitting the debit certificate, the lender will not provide you with the loan because the credit risk for them in a property that still has fees is high. The debit certificate contains all the details of the transactions made on the property from the date of registration until now.

Now the question arises, why should you need proof of income to take advantage of such a loan? B Khata is completely different from A Khata. B Khata contains the names of properties on which unpaid taxes are levied. And the taxes have not yet been given. Properties located in B Khata have not yet received a Chata certificate or legal status. Buying and selling a property can incur taxes. That is why you need to collect all the tax revenue from the previous owner so that you can know that he paid all the taxes on time and that no tax due on the property you are buying is due. This real estate document also helps to verify the legal status of the property so that it is useful for the lender and your loan application can be approved quickly. Here is an article about some types of loan documents. Also known as a purchase agreement, this is one of the most important real estate documents for a home loan. Need to think about what exactly the purchase contract is? Well, the purchase contract is a written agreement between a buyer and a seller on the sale of the property. This is all the details (general conditions) related to the sale of real estate that will take place in the future between the buyer and the seller. A purchase agreement does not give you any rights or interest in the property.

This document, known as a power of attorney, is necessary to find out if the previous sale or purchase of the home – for which you want a loan amount – was made by an authorized person on behalf of the buyer or seller. This document is a legal instrument by which a person gives another person the power to act on their behalf as the legal representative to make all financial decisions relating to the property, including the sale and purchase on behalf of the buyer or seller. It is very important to have khata from a property as you need a khata to take the electrical connection, the water connection and even for any type of loan. As mentioned earlier, lenders provide 75% to 90% of the total value of the property as the loan amount. You will need to fund the remaining amount, known as a down payment, from your own sources. This is usually between 10% and 25% of the total value of the property. Therefore, a lender will need the OCR (Own Contribution Receipt) with the bank statement to verify that you have made your contribution in the form of a deposit to the seller. .
